In Sara Gruen's Water for Elephants, Jacob Jankowski embarks on a journey filled with hardship and discovery during the Great Depression. As a young veterinarian forced to join a traveling circus, Jacob learns about love, loss, and survival against all odds. His story illustrates how adversity can shape one's character and lead to unexpected triumphs. These diverse portrayals demonstrate the versatility of the name Jacob in storytelling.

Jacob's significance extends beyond fictional realms into religious texts, where he appears prominently in the Bible. Known for wrestling with an angel, Jacob receives a new name—Israel—symbolizing his struggle and victory over divine forces. This biblical account emphasizes the transformative power of perseverance and faith, themes echoed in many literary works featuring characters named Jacob.

In the television series Lost, Jacob represents mystery and destiny, guiding key players toward their fates while remaining enigmatic himself. Created by Damon Lindelof and Carlton Cuse, this version of Jacob invites audiences to ponder deeper questions about purpose and identity.
